Transaction 633b26eef35ccd502a93753be04bb6eb0c04eb3459c2647c11d2c349c4c1fecf

1 Input
1 Outputs
  • 633b26eef35ccd502a93753be04bb6eb0c04eb3459c2647c11d2c349c4c1fecf:0
  • value  12590000
    address  19hB6pmEKxjYh7bjXa4g8fRZjyBsf8RSH3